Where Ancients Tread turns every 5-power creature entering the battlefield into a free Shock — except it's 5 damage, which kills most things in Commander on the spot. The five-mana setup cost is real, but in decks that routinely drop Polyraptor or flood the board through Omnath, Locus of Rage, each trigger is a removal spell or a face-burn clock that costs nothing extra.
Best Commanders
Commanders with the highest synergy

Omnath, Locus of Rage
Omnath, Locus of Rage makes 5/5 Elementals whenever a land enters, so Where Ancients Tread converts every land drop into a 5-damage missile — an engine that can clear the board or close the game without attacking.

Vrondiss, Rage of Ancients
Vrondiss, Rage of Ancients spawns 3/3 Dragon Spirit tokens when it takes damage, and those tokens trigger Where Ancients Tread the moment they enter — chaining damage without needing any other setup.

Mayael the Anima
Mayael the Anima cheats 5-power creatures directly onto the battlefield, and Where Ancients Tread turns each of those free drops into guaranteed removal or damage before the creature even gets to swing.

Where Ancients Tread is a Commander card through and through — the five-mana cost is irrelevant when games go long, and the payoff compounds every time a big creature hits the battlefield. In Legacy and Vintage it's technically legal but never sees play; the five-mana enchantment is far too slow for formats where games end on turn one or two. Oathbreaker can support it in the right big-creature shell, though the tighter game length makes the setup feel heavier than in Commander. If you're playing a 5-power-matter strategy, Commander is the only format where Where Ancients Tread is worth a slot.
